Toolbox - CIA World Factbook
The CIA World Fact Book
The CIA World Factbook provides information for 267 world entities. There is some special functionality as well that will allow you to...
The CIA World Fact Book
The CIA World Factbook provides information for 267 world entities. There is some special functionality as well that will allow you to make charts and compare and contrast different countries. You can also export comparisons to excel for further manipulation.
To find the CIA World Fact Book, click 'Find a Book'. It is located in the 'Geography' Section.
If you start on the Contents tab, you can select a country of interest. I'll choose India. Here I'll find the flag, a map, and then when I scroll down the page i see information on the
history, geography, people&society;, government, economy, communications, transportation, military, and transnational issues
At the top of the page, just below the map, I have a drop down menu with which I can choose a country to compare with India. I'll choose Canada. Canada appears to the right of India, and I can scroll down the page to see the similarities and differences between the two countries.
I can add as many countries as I want.
If my chart becomes too big, I can remove countries by clicking the "hide" button.
You can also create dynamic tables, comparing and contrasting specific features of each country as listed on the left.
I'll click Area -
I am brought to a page that has the the worlds countries listed alphabetically, with their areas in kilometers listed in the column on the right. To sort the list by Area, click the 'sort' button. Now the list is sorted from largest to smallest (including oceans).
You can view your data in Table or chart format.
I can continue adding features to compare and contrast. I'll choose population. Then sort by population. I'll view the chart, where i'll see area listed in red and population in blue.
Back to my table, I can continue adding comparisons. I'll choose literacy percentage. And then view my chart. At any point, I can export my table or chart and capture the data in excel - where I can further manipulate it in any way I choose.
Find the CIA World Fact Book in your 'Find a Book' bookshelf. Or in your keyword results. (China)

CIA World Factbook restores Dokdo Island back to map of Korea
미 CIA, 한국편 지도에 독
We begin with news that the Korea-controlled Dokdo Island has been restored to the CIA World Factbook′s map of Korea.
The change came after it was found that, f...
We begin with news that the Korea-controlled Dokdo Island has been restored to the CIA World Factbook′s map of Korea.
The change came after it was found that, following its latest update, the U.S. intelligence agency′s map did not refer to or show Dokdo when visitors clicked on Korea,... but showed it on the map of Japan,... which continues to make territorial claims to the Korean islets.
The CIA told Korea′s foreign ministry that Dokdo... referred to as the Liancourt Rocks on the map... was not shown due to technical glitches as they were modifying the maps.
Up until this glitch, the CIA′s World Factbook had marked the Liancourt Rocks on maps of Korea and Japan.
The factbook uses ′Sea of Japan′ for the body of water between Korea and Japan.
Korea wants the U.S. to acknowledge that Koreans call it the ′East Sea′ and put both names on the map.

FIPS 10-4
The FIPS 10-4 standard, Countries, Dependencies, Areas of Special Sovereignty, and Their Principal Administrative Divisions, lists two-letter country codes that...
The FIPS 10-4 standard, Countries, Dependencies, Areas of Special Sovereignty, and Their Principal Administrative Divisions, lists two-letter country codes that are used by the U.S. Government for geographical data processing in many publications, such as the CIA World Factbook. The standard is also known as DAFIF 0413 ed 7 Amdt. No. 3 and as DIA 65-18.
The FIPS 10-4 codes are similar to the 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country codes. The standard also includes codes for the top-level subdivision of the countries, similar to but usually incompatible with the ISO 3166-2 standard.

World Poverty: Can We End Poverty Overnight? - Learn Liberty
Americans make up around four percent of the world population and yet they control over 25% of the world's wealth. If that wealth were shared evenly across the ...
Americans make up around four percent of the world population and yet they control over 25% of the world's wealth. If that wealth were shared evenly across the globe, couldn't we solve the problem of global poverty overnight? Learn more: http://bit.ly/1TrH23v
The answer unfortunately is no. Sharing one's wealth with those who have less is admirable and it often helps to relieve immediate suffering. But just sharing existing wealth we'll never be enough to lift billions of people out of poverty in a sustainable way. To understand why we need to look at history.
This chart shows how world GDP per capita as changed from the earliest recorded history until today. In other words, it's a shorthand way of seeing the wealth of the average human being over time. There are two things we can learn from this chart.
The first is that the extreme poverty we see today is not just a modern affliction. For the vast majority of people throughout most of human history, extreme poverty has been all they have ever known, and all their children would ever know. The second thing is that starting around 1800, that suddenly began to change. We’re living longer healthier lives and seeing fewer of our children die.
On average we're better educated, more literate, and better fed. Transportation is faster, safer, and cheaper. In many ways it's been the poorest among us who have benefited the most from these changes. What's made life so remarkably better for the poor wasn’t welfare or charity. No matter how you redistributed it, all the wealth of the world in 1800 wouldn't be anywhere near enough to give us the standard of living we enjoy in developed countries today.
What happened was the creation of new wealth on an enormous scale. In other words, economic growth. That's why we’re living better lives than our ancestors, today. And that's why the number of people living in absolute poverty has plummeted, not just in the last 200 years, but in the last 20. In a way, economic growth has been history's most successful anti poverty program. But not all countries have experienced this amazing level of growth. Which is why many people are still trapped in poverty today. So if you really want to help the world’s poor, fostering economic growth ought to be our first priority. What new policies might help to grow the wealth of developing countries more quickly? Which existing policies are actually hindering that growth? Those are the questions we need to answer.

Global Economics Explained: The Secret World of Economic Hit Men and Corruption (2012)
According to Perkins, he began writing Confessions of an Economic Hit Man in the 1980s, but "threats or bribes always convinced [him] to stop."
According to his...
According to Perkins, he began writing Confessions of an Economic Hit Man in the 1980s, but "threats or bribes always convinced [him] to stop."
According to his book, Perkins' function was to convince the political and financial leadership of underdeveloped countries to accept enormous development loans from institutions like the World Bank and USAID. Saddled with debts they could not hope to pay, those countries were forced to acquiesce to political pressure from the United States on a variety of issues. Perkins argues in his book that developing nations were effectively neutralized politically, had their wealth gaps driven wider and economies crippled in the long run. In this capacity Perkins recounts his meetings with some prominent individuals, including Graham Greene and Omar Torrijos. Perkins describes the role of an EHM as follows:
Economic hit men (EHMs) are highly paid professionals who cheat countries around the globe out of trillions of dollars. They funnel money from the World Bank, the U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ID), and other foreign "aid" organizations into the coffers of huge corporations and the pockets of a few wealthy families who control the planet's natural resources. Their tools included fraudulent financial reports, rigged elections, payoffs, extortion, sex, and murder. They play a game as old as empire, but one that has taken on new and terrifying dimensions during this time of globalization.
The epilogue to the 2006 edition provides a rebuttal to the current move by the G8 nations to forgive Third World debt. Perkins charges that the proposed conditions for this debt forgiveness require countries to privatise their health, education, electric, water and other public services. Those countries would also have to discontinue subsidies and trade restrictions that support local business, but accept the continued subsidization of certain G8 businesses by the US and other G8 countries, and the erection of trade barriers on imports that threaten G8 industries.
In the book, Perkins repeatedly denies the existence of a "conspiracy." Instead, Perkins carefully discusses the role of corporatocracy.[2] -- November 4, 2004 interview
I was initially recruited while I was in business school back in the late sixties by the National Security Agency, the nation's largest and least understood spy organization; but ultimately I worked for private corporations. The first real economic hit man was back in the early 1950s, Kermit Roosevelt, Jr., the grandson of Teddy, who overthrew the government of Iran, a democratically elected government, Mossadegh's government who was Time's magazine person of the year; and he was so successful at doing this without any bloodshed—well, there was a little bloodshed, but no military intervention, just spending millions of dollars and replaced Mossadegh with the Shah of Iran. At that point, we understood that this idea of economic hit man was an extremely good one. We didn't have to worry about the threat of war with Russia when we did it this way. The problem with that was that Roosevelt was a C.I.A. agent. He was a government employee. Had he been caught, we would have been in a lot of trouble. It would have been very embarrassing. So, at that point, the decision was made to use organizations like the C.I.A. and the N.S.A. to recruit potential economic hit men like me and then send us to work for private consulting companies, engineering firms, construction companies, so that if we were caught, there would be no connection with the government.
Columnist Sebastian Mallaby of The Washington Post reacted sharply to Perkins' book:[3] "This man is a frothing conspiracy theorist, a vainglorious peddler of nonsense, and yet his book, Confessions of an Economic Hit Man, is a runaway bestseller." Mallaby, who spent 13 years writing for the London Economist and wrote a critically well-received biography of World Bank chief James Wolfensohn,[4] holds that Perkins' conception of international finance is "largely a dream" and that his "basic contentions are flat wrong".[3] For instance he points out that Indonesia reduced its infant mortality and illiteracy rates by two-thirds after economists persuaded its leaders to borrow money in 1970. He also disputes Perkins' claim that 51 of the top 100 world economies belong to companies. A value-added comparison done by the UN, he says, shows the number to be 29. (The 51 of 100 data comes from an Institute for Policy Studies Dec 2000 Report on the Top 200 corporations; using 2010 data from the CIA's World Factbook and Fortune Global 500[5][6] the current ratio is 114 corporations in the top 200 global economies.)

List of religious populations
This is a list of religious populations by proportion and population. Estimates made by reliable sources differ. The CIA's World Factbook gives the population a...
This is a list of religious populations by proportion and population. Estimates made by reliable sources differ. The CIA's World Factbook gives the population as 7,021,836,029 and the distribution of religions as Christian 33.39% , Muslim 22.74%, Hindu 13.8%, Buddhist 6.77%, Sikh 0.35%, Jewish 0.22%, Baha'i 0.11%, other religions 10.95%, non-religious 9.66%, atheists 2.01% .
